Deputy Darragh O'Brien asked the Minister for Foreign Affairs and Trade the discussions that he or his officials had with the permanent representative of Ireland to the UN prior to the vote on Saudi Arabia's membership of the UN Commission on the Status of Women; and if he will make a statement on the matter. [22847/17]
